日期:2014-05-16  浏览次数:20428 次

关于获取选定的option的offsettop的问题
关于获取选定的option的offsettop的问题
onchange="alert(this.options[this.selectedIndex].offsettop)"

总是为零,不是应该根据选择的项不同而变化么?

------解决方案--------------------
要把T大写offsetTop,另外估计是因为这些option都是基于select的,所以他们相对于select来说offsetTop为0吧,只是我估计。
------解决方案--------------------
路过,
ie里select是怪胎
出现什么情况都不用惊奇
------解决方案--------------------
option属于非渲染元素,所以无法获取offsetTop。(传说IE6的下拉是通过winAPI创建的,这个我也不是很清楚)